A kind of method that utilizes aquatic protein and feather meal to ferment and prepare small growth-promoting peptides for poultry
A technology for hydrolyzing feather meal and promoting growth, applied in the application, animal feed, animal husbandry and other directions, can solve the problems of high production cost and large amount, and achieve the effects of low production cost, increased energy consumption, and reduced production cost

Embodiment 1
[0027] Embodiment 1: the heat-resistant facultative anaerobic bacteria capable of producing keratinase preserved on a slant Bacillus methylotrophicus HL-4 was inserted into the LB liquid medium cooled after sterilization, and cultured at 55°C and 150r / min for 12h, and prepared into Bacillus methylotrophicus The HL-4 seed solution is reserved. Fresh tilapia scraps are minced for later use; 20 kg of minced tilapia scraps, 5 kg of hydrolyzed feather meal and 100 kg of water are added to the enzymatic hydrolysis tank, and 50 g of them are added to the enzymatic hydrolysis tank Glucose, 520 grams of calcium chloride, 320 grams of zinc chloride, 500 grams of ferrous chloride and 550 grams of dipotassium hydrogen phosphate are mixed to obtain a fermentation medium; add 8 kg to the fermentation medium in the enzymolysis tank Bacillus methylotrophicus HL-4 seed liquid; control the fermentation temperature at 55°C to 60°C, the rotation speed at 50rpm to 100rpm, and the time for...
Embodiment 2
[0028] Embodiment 2: the heat-resistant facultative anaerobic bacteria capable of producing keratinase preserved on slant Bacillus methylotrophicus HL-4 was inserted into the LB liquid medium cooled after sterilization, and cultured at 55°C and 150r / min for 12h, and prepared into Bacillus methylotrophicus The HL-4 seed solution is reserved. Mince fresh Antarctic krill for later use. Add 25 kg of minced Antarctic krill, 6 kg of hydrolyzed feather meal and 100 kg of water into the enzymolysis tank, and add 60 g of glucose, 450 g of calcium chloride, 380 g of zinc chloride, Mix 555 grams of ferrous chloride and 650 grams of dipotassium hydrogen phosphate to obtain a fermentation medium; add 8 kilograms to the fermentation medium in the enzymolysis tank Bacillus methylotrophicusHL-4 seed liquid; control the fermentation temperature at 55°C to 60°C, the rotation speed at 50rpm to 100rpm, and the time for 66h; after the fermentation, the fermentation liquid is filtered to rem...
